**Q: What should I check when a PR vendors a new third-party font?**

A: First, verify the license file is included alongside the font binaries in `third_party/fonts/` — the Tellwick build will fail closed without it. Second, confirm the font is listed in the Norrow Systems approved-typeface registry; unlisted fonts need a legal sign-off before merge. Third, check that subsetting was done with our pinned tooling so output is deterministic. If any of these checks are unclear, contact the platform-legal liaison at the address below.

escalation mailbox, hadug-bajog: sormir@norvalabs.internal

Ticket: Staging env misconfigured for Siftgate bloom filter

The bloom layer in front of the Pellet KV store is rejecting all lookups in staging because the env file was copied from the dev template without credentials. False-positive tuning values are fine; only the auth line is missing. To unblock the weekly demo, the Pellet admission secret must be set on the following line.

env line for yaguf-fajop: LEDGER_TOKEN13=fb08984397349

Welcome to Pixelhollow. Our thumbnail cache leaked memory for months because evicted entries kept decoded bitmaps alive via a listener reference. The fix ships in release 4.2; watch heap graphs for the first hour after rollout. Release builds must be signed with the key below before promotion.

deploy key for kajof-fajop: bky6_gDHw9Q

## CI Troubleshooting: Stale Cache in Plugin Builds

Following the Fernwick stale-cache incident, the Loomhaven CI runners now key plugin caches on a combined hash of the lockfile and the plugin manifest version. If your plugin picks up outdated dependencies, confirm you bumped the manifest version — a lockfile-only change no longer invalidates the cache by itself. Clearing caches manually is rarely needed and should be a last resort. When filing a report, include the trace token printed below your build summary.

trace token, fawig-fawef: htk3_0ee